2002 CHARDONNAY 'Kistler Vineyard'. Sonoma Valley, California
Alcohol Percentage: 14.1%
Old Bridge Rating: Kistler are the most sought after producer of Chardonnay outside Burgundy. Their wines sell out by mail-order on release. We imported this and the others ourselves as soon as they were available. The consistency is extraordinary, even though the prices are certainly eye-watering.
Press Reviews: 94-96 points Robert Parker: "A profound effort from the dynamic Kistler-Bixler duo is the 2002 Chardonnay Kistler Vineyard. Spectacular ripeness along with a liquid minerality give this large-scaled, bigger than life Chardonnay tremendous balance/equilibrium. This compelling, full-bodied, dense wine offers smoky hazelnut characteristics intermixed with oranges, lemons, tropical fruits, and hints of Grand Marnier as well as caramel. There is a lot going on in this full-bodied, concentrated yet impeccably well-balanced offering. It should drink well for a decade."
93 points Stephen Tanzer's International Wine Cellar: "Medium yellow. Superripe, musky aromas of orange oil, ginger, charred oak and light sulfides. Sweet and full in the mouth, but with a penetrating quality to the pineapple and spice flavors. This, too, is very light on its feet. Finishes elegant, juicy and long, with an enticing mineral edge to its flavors."
